The temperature and number of moles are held constant. This means that this uses Boyle's Law. (The ideal gas law could be manipulated to give us this result when T and n are held constant.)
PV = k
where k is a constant.
This means that
P₁V₁ = k = P₂V₂
P₁V₁ = P₂V₂
(1 atm) * (1 L) = (2 atm) * V₂
V₂ = 0.5 L
The new volume of the gas is 0.5 L.

Answer:
The correct answer is - transparent medium.
Explanation:
A transparent substance or medium is the substance that allows light to pass through it. Light moves through these substances as they do not absorb the light and do not reflect too.
The example of such substances is glass, air or water. These substances allow light to pass through them.
